Bagh: On the 1 hand, the central and state governments are operating a scheme to make the farming small business lucrative for the farmers, on the other hand, the farmers are worried about their crops as they are facing energy troubles.
In the Baidipura Faliya of Gram Panchayat Akhada below Bagh district, the farmers are grappling with erratic energy provide and are worried about their upcoming wheat and gram crops.
Local farmers told Free Press, that earlier their crops had been broken due to rains and now the lack of energy may possibly harm their crops as there is electrical energy for just an hour or so. They stay awake the complete evening although waiting for electrical energy, in vain, they stated. In such a situation it will develop into tricky for them to make each ends meet, they complained. Moreover, departmental officials are also not providing them suitable answers connected to their troubles.
Farmers apprised that most of the farmers have signed an agreement just before taking the connection that we will spend the electrical energy bills immediately after the harvest, in spite of that they have to be concerned about electrical energy for hours. They stated that below such situations farming can’t develop into a lucrative small business.
When the problem was discussed with the regional electrical energy division officer, Lokendra Patel, he stated that these who got agreements of paying the bills immediately after harvests, have nevertheless not paid the bills. They stated to clear the bills immediately after Diwali, but the bills are nevertheless not cleared, he stated. Patel stated that they have stress from larger authorities and they will be capable to resolve their troubles, after they clear the pending bills.
